Company Description

Sika Australia Pty Ltd is a well-established industry leader in the manufacturing of construction chemicals servicing Construction, Industry, & Mining divisions across Australia.

We are a Global Organization with subsidiaries in over 103 countries around the world, we manufacture in over 400 factories with over 33,000 employees & an expanding team across Australia. 

Job Description

  • Collaborating with research and development teams to develop specialized construction chemical products specifically designed for tunnel construction.
  • Providing technical support and guidance to customers, contractors, and internal teams regarding the use and application of construction chemical products in tunnelling projects.
  • Developing and implementing the product strategy for the tunnelling segment. This involves setting goals, defining target markets, identifying product differentiation, and positioning the company's products effectively in the tunnelling industry.
  • Managing the entire product portfolio for tunnelling applications.
  • Conducting market research and analysis to identify customer needs and market trends specific to the tunnelling segment.
  • Collaborating with the sales and marketing teams to provide technical expertise and support in promoting and selling tunnelling products.
  • Conducting competitive analysis to understand the strengths and weaknesses of competitor products in the tunnelling segment.
  • Building relationships and collaborating with industry experts, consultants, and research institutions specializing in tunnelling to stay updated with the latest advancements and trends.

Qualifications

  • Must have a Tertiary qualification in Civil, Geotechnical, or Mining Engineering or other relevant engineering disciplines.
  • A minimum of 5 years’ relevant experience within the tunnelling industry.
  • A thorough understanding of TBM’s, NATM and relevant tunnelling product knowledge.
  • Experience and knowledge of construction chemicals and sprayed concrete

What you need to know about the Sydney Tech Scene

From opera to comedy shows, the Sydney Opera House hosts more than 1,600 performances a year, yet its entertainment sector isn't the only one taking center stage. The city's tech sector has earned a reputation as one of the fastest-growing in the region. More specifically, its IT sector stands out as the country's third-largest, growing at twice the rate of overall employment in the past decade as businesses continue to digitize their operations to stay competitive.
